  • The REAL reason Princess Diana agreed to a secret hotel meeting with JFK Jr. revealed – and the intimate letter she wrote him after their private get-together

    The REAL reason Princess Diana agreed to a secret hotel meeting with JFK Jr. revealed – and the intimate letter she wrote him after their private get-together

    In 1995, Princess Diana and John F. Kennedy Jr. were two of the most closely-watched people on the planet – so organizing a secret meeting between the two of them was no easy feat.

    But that is exactly what their respective staffers managed to orchestrate during a brief trip that Diana made to New York City, the details of which have been kept largely under wraps. Until now.

    The meeting was initially arranged at the behest of JFK Jr. who had hoped to convince the newly-separated Diana to appear on the cover of his magazine, George. However a new biography detailing the life of the political scion has now revealed that her real reasons for agreeing to the meet-up may have been far less formal.

    ‘It was never made public so that made it quite fun, actually,’ Diana’s private secretary, Patrick Jephson, recalls in the pages of JFK Jr: An Intimate Oral Biography, written by RoseMarie Terenzio, Kennedy’s former executive assistant, and Liz McNeil.

    ‘Diana wanted it to be discreet because it had all the makings of a great gossip story, didn’t it? World’s most eligible bachelor… and she had just got unmarried or was in the process of getting unmarried. It would’ve been a rather intriguing thing to dream about.

    ‘She didn’t want that, but she was curious to meet him. Partly, I think, because Sarah Ferguson had the hots for him and Diana wanted to, I think, do one up on her.’

    RoseMarie, Kennedy’s former executive assistant and chief of staff at George, writes that Diana was due to be staying at the Carlyle hotel, and she’d arranged for a meeting with the princess on a weekday afternoon to discuss the potential cover.

    ‘There was all this worry,’ she recalls. ‘Should he go in the front door? Should he wear a disguise: because won’t there be rumors that he’s having an affair with her? … They were the two most famous people on the planet.’

    In the end, he walked right through the front door without being noticed, avoiding the paparazzi who were waiting around the side for Diana.

    Jephson met Kennedy outside the hotel’s Bemelmans Bar in a ‘rather dark passageway’ and took him up to the penthouse, where Diana was staying.

    ‘He was smart. And she was smart,’ he recalls. ‘It was a working meeting. Business attire.’

    However, Jephson says Kennedy seemed in awe of the beautiful woman sitting opposite him, explaining that he was ‘not uncomfortable but he certainly seemed to be on his best behavior.

    ‘He rather sat on the edge of his chair and looked nervously at her,’ he continues.

    ‘She was very cool – and jolly, you know, and smiley and welcoming.’

    He made his pitch for the cover and Diana respectfully declined, with Cindy Crawford ultimately going on to serve as Kennedy’s cover star, but the pair continued talking until their allotted time was over.

    ‘I can’t remember the words,’ says Jephson, ‘but there was a degree of sympathy. I think she might have spoken about the famous picture of him as a little boy.

    ‘And she had sympathy for him growing up with the name and being the object of public fascination. These were things that she could relate to.

    ‘She didn’t see him as the rest of the world saw him. As this big, famous, handsome guy. She saw him, I think, as rather vulnerable because he had grown up in public.

    ‘She saw in him a fellow victim… of life in the public eye and difficulty knowing who to trust. And I think that that did create a connection between them.’

    Terenzio reveals that Diana and JFK Jr stayed in touch, and he asked her again for an interview two years later.

    ‘On February 3, 1997, she wrote John a note from Kensington Palace. I still have a copy of it,’ she writes

    ‘She said “regrettably” she must decline his offer and that she would get back in touch when the time was right. At the end, she wrote: “I hope” – and she underlined “hope” – ‘the media are leaving both you and Carolyn alone. I know how difficult it is, but believe it or not, the worst paparazzi are here in Europe.’

    Matt Berman, the creative director of George, reflected on the deep irony of that first meeting at the Carlyle: ‘I sent him over with a bunch of covers. I would draw sketches – Magic Marker on tracing paper.

    ‘I did one of her in a limousine with paparazzi flash bulbs – it was her in the back with the windows half up.

    ‘How weird is that? They were both not gonna be around in the next few years. Who would’ve called that one?’

    JFK Jr: An Intimate Oral Biography by RoseMarie Terenzio and Liz McNeil, is published by Gallery Books

    BECKS APPEAL David Beckham’s Inter Miami at centre of MLS scandal with rivals furious at spot in controversial tournament

    INTER MIAMI’S addition to the Club World Cup has left Major League Soccer rivals furious with Fifa.

    Gianni Infantino, the Fifa president, announced this week that David Beckham’s MLS franchise will take the America host nation spot for next summer’s controversial tournament.

    Infantino pointed to Inter Miami winning the Supporters Shield, awarded to the club who perform the best over the regular season, as the reason for their qualification.

    The actual MLS champion is decided through the play-offs.

    But with the reason for Miami’s inclusion not given before they lifted the trophy, their rivals have accused Fifa of having no clear qualification criteria.

    And they claim they have jumped the gun simply to ensure that Lionel Messi is involved in the revamped 32-team tournament.

    Seattle Sounders are the other team from the US involved and they booked their spot having won the Concacaf Champions Cup in 2022.

    Fifa had been in discussions with MLS over criteria this season, before deciding on the Supporters Shield winner at their Council meeting on October 3 – the day after Miami sealed the title.

    MLS insist all decision-making around the final slot was dealt with by the world governing body.

    Not only have Beckham’s boys been given the host nation spot, but they will also play in the curtain raiser in Miami on June 15.

    BBC Antiques Roadshow guest in tears as sculpture he used as doorstop turns out to be worth huge sum

    Antiques Roadshow guest was left in disbelief when a sculpture he had been using as a doorstop turned out to be a rare piece by celebrated Nigerian artist Ben Enwonwu

    An Antiques Roadshow punter was gobsmacked during Sunday’s episode when a quirky car boot bargain sculpture he had been using as a doorstop turned out to be a rare treasure worth a small fortune.

    Broadcast from the picturesque Beaumaris Castle on Anglesey, Fiona Bruce and her team dug up some gems, including what might be an original Winnie the Pooh edition, a dazzling ballerina brooch and a quirky wooden chair by the legendary ‘Mouseman’, Robert Thompson.

    Stealing the show though, was one visitor’s peculiar piece, which he confessed puzzled him, remarking: “I’ve always been perplexed by it, wondering what it is.”

    He amusingly added: “It’s been my doorstop for the last 12 months,” mentioning he snagged it for a mere £50 at a local car boot sale in Anglesey three years earlier. Clueless about its background, he mused: “Someone mentioned it could be African; I don’t know.”

    Expert John Foster then delivered the shocker – revealing the sculpture as the creation of Ben Enwonwu, a giant in Nigerian art history.

    Foster painted a picture of Enwonwu’s prestigious journey, a man who flawlessly fused Nigerian and Western art techniques, gaining recognition in the 1940s thanks to the Zwemmer Gallery, before spreading his influence through exhibits from New York to London and Milan. Foster continued, “The sculptor Ben Enwonwu [is] one of Nigeria’s most celebrated sculptors. He was born in Nigeria in 1917 and died in the sort of mid-90s.”, reports the Express.

    Expounding on the artist’s reputation, notably with bronze and stone, Foster speculated that the carved stone work likely hailed from the 1970s.

    The expert revealed: “He was the first pioneer in mixing Nigerian art with Western art. Known really as a sculptor in bronze and stone, and this being in carved stone style-wise I thought it sort of dates from the 1970s. He was picked up by a gallery in the 40s and it was a gallery called the Zwemmer Gallery. And that, literally from there, skyrocketed him to having shows in New York, London and Milan.”

    Exclusive: Judi Love reveals her next big plan, vowing ‘we should never limit ourselves’

    As her new food travel show hits ITV this week, comedian Judi Love opens up about love, her mental health, juggling work and teens and her next goal

    Judi Love’s lifelong mantra is that laughter is healing – so it’s perhaps no surprise that the comedian now plans to do a PhD on the subject.

    The 44-year-old Loose Women presenter, who already has two university degrees under her belt, says her future goals are not limited to the world of entertainment. Although she would like to be the next Cilla Black. “I’d love to reboot Blind Date,” she laughs, with that unmistakable cackle. “Let’s manifest it, I’m going to put that on my vision board.”

    With her brand new ITV foodie travel show on screens this week, Judi Love’s Culinary Cruise, a stand-up tour in the works, not to mention regular appearances on Loose Women and comedy panel shows, Judi is at the top of her game. But it hasn’t always been easy, coming from a working class background in London, raising two children as a single mum and facing discrimination as a black woman. She says: “There were many days I remember, being in my council property and fretting, being nervous, thinking, ‘How am I going to get through this week? What am I going to do?’ There’s something creative in me and I just want people to feel some kind of joy. That was my thing.

  • Priti Patel tied in knots by BBC’s Laura Kuenssberg on past Donald Trump comments

    Priti Patel tied in knots by BBC’s Laura Kuenssberg on past Donald Trump comments

    Shadow Foreign Secretary Priti Patel was called out for digging up old comments Labour politicians had made about Donald Trump but seemingly not wanting to confront her own words

    Dame Priti Patel was tied in knots after being grilled about her past comments appearing to accuse Donald Trump of stoking violence ahead of the January 6 insurrection.

    The former Home Secretary, who has been appointed Kemi Badenoch’s Shadow Foreign Secretary, was called out for digging up old comments from Labour politicians but seemingly not wanting to confront her own words. Dame Priti told Laura Kuenssberg that there was “no point fast forwarding now and taking quotes into the modern context” despite hitting out at Foreign Secretary David Lammy’s previous comments about President-elect Mr Trump.

    In a tense exchange, the BBC presenter told the Tory politician: “You said several times that you think this government has to work really, really hard to make to make good, maybe to make peace, with Donald Trump in order to move forward. I just wonder, after the Capitol riots back on January 6… you yourself said that Donald Trump’s comments directly led to violence, and he did very little to deescalate the situation. Do you want to apologise to him for saying that, as you’re urging Labour politicians to do?”

    Dame Priti Patel there was 'no point fast forwarding now and taking quotes into the modern context' yet criticised Labour politician's old comments
    Dame Priti Patel said there was ‘no point fast forwarding now and taking quotes into the modern context’ yet criticised Labour politician’s old comments
    Dame Priti said the 2021 insurrection was “a major, major situation”. “I was Home Secretary at the time then and we were obviously working with our US counterparts on security issues. No one wants to see violence after elections,” she said.

    After being repeatedly pressed on whether she stood by the comments, she said: “I think those comments, in light of what happened, were absolutely right and fair and relevant. The crucial thing right now, Laura, is that you’ve asked me about previous comments, and previous comments of our chief diplomat [Mr Lammy] were much more personal – much more personal – and undiplomatic to the President-elect of the United States.

    BBC presenter Laura Kuenssberg grilled Dame Priti Patel on whether she stood by her old comments about Donald Trump
    BBC presenter Laura Kuenssberg grilled Dame Priti Patel on whether she stood by her old comments about Donald Trump
    “And let me just add one other thing, our relationships and I have worked with the previous Trump administration, I’ve had a very strong working relationship on security issues, law enforcement issues… That relationship is built on trust and respect. This government, I suspect will have to work that much harder to regain trust and respect.”

    Asked whether she still held that view that Mr Trump was, in that moment, a threat to democracy, Dame Priti said: “At that particular time… Let me just put this into context. There’s no point fast forwarding now and taking quotes into the modern context.”

    Mr Lammy has dismissed comments he made branding Mr Trump “deluded, dishonest, xenophobic, narcissistic” as “old news” – and he said the pair got on well at a recent dinner. “You will struggle to find any politician. And that’s not just Labour politicians, because the last Foreign Secretary, David Cameron, had some pretty ripe things to say about Donald Trump,” the Foreign Secretary told BBC Newscast on Thursday.
